                  Say fellers, don't forget to update your hunting reports. Be honest on them. We are responsible for our own future. This will have an impact on our future privileges. They know that some hunters will skew the numbers thinking it is to the hunters advantage. That is not always so. Being honest on the serves is very key to our privileges in the future. They depend on our honesty at the present.

                  So far as of today, we have 882 permitted hunters. Only 5% have updated their reports. If you begin to update now, you will also have met the serve dead line .

                  Example:
                  1a) if to few deer have been seen in an area, (should we go to the forbidden word that starts with an "L" and ends with an "O" and in between are "ott") the area may get fewer permits to hunt it in the future.

                  1b) if to few deer have been seen in an area, the area may just be shut down.

                  2) If the population is good then less chance of regulation.

                  ACE dose view this thread often. Several are members of this website, as they are hunters also . They just don't post often.

                  Most on here know they check for parking permits on the vehicles via the little "reminders" and "Thank You"s they leave under the wipers (very nicely done this time with the lamination BTW). On your parking permit is your permit number. What if they started taking numbers down and checking to see who has updated ? What if the dead line was cut down to two-four weeks per hunter visit ? Waco has a one week dead line. I hope it never comes to that. But we are responsible for our own future. Just some thoughts .

                                Be the first one in, go farther than anyone else, be the last one out. The hunters comming in will push deer to you and when they get down for lunch and come back at 4 or 5 they will push deer again. If anyone asks "did ya see anything?" say no
                                Seriously, hunt hard to find spots and hunt it hard and long, stay in the stand while every one else gets down. Good luck.
